This website presents an overview of the main academic projects I am involved in, as well as an access to some of my writings.
Three intellectual projects have kept me busy in recent years:
- » Contributing to reflections and debates about the place and nature of social sciences knowledge in today’s societies
- » Contributing to the development of ‘positioning theory’ as a new framework for studying human interactions
- » Contributing to the study of regions as new ways of global and local governance
